    Why Use It ?

    To focus efforts on the problems that offer the greatest potential

    for improvement by showing their relative frequency or size in a

    descending bar graph

    What Does It Do?

    Helps a team to focus on those causes that will have the

    greatest impact if solved

    Based on the proven Pareto principle: 20% of the sources cause80% of any problem

    Displays the relative importance of problems in simple, quickly

    interpreted format

    Progress is measured in a highly visible format that provides

    incentive to push on for more improvement

    Pareto Chart

    Histogram

    What Does It Do?

    Shows the relative frequency of occurrence of the various data

    values

    Reveals the centering, variation, and shape of the data

    Provides useful information for predicting future performance of the

    process

    Helps to indicate if there has been a change in the processHelps answer the question, Is the process capable of meeting my

    customer requirements?

    Displays large amounts of data that are difficult to interpret in

    tabular form

    Histogram

    Why Use It?

    To summarize data from a process that has been collected over a

    period of time, and graphically present its frequency distribution in abar form

    To give a quick estimate of the process center, spread, and shape

    Run Chart

    Why Use It ?

    To allow a team to study observed data (a performance measure of

    a process) for trends or patterns over a specified period of time

    What Does It Do?

    Monitors the performance of one or more processes over time todetect trends or patterns over a specified period of time

    Allows a team to compare a performance measure before and after

    implementation of a solution to measure its impact Tracks useful information for predicting trends

    Correlation vs. Causality Beware Just because two variables are correlated does not mean

    that one variable causes the other

    A plot of the population of Oldenburg at the end of each yearagainst the number of storks in that year, 1930-1936 Statistics

    for Experimenters by Box, Hunter and Hunter

    Boxplot

    Why Use It?

    To give you a graphical summary of values and help you

    identify extreme values

    What Does It Do?

    Represents roughly the middle 50% of the data in the rectangular

    box

    Represents the general extent of the data via lines or whiskersextending from either side

    Marks outliers (observations far from the rest of the data)
